22 /*
23 Driver: adv_pci1723
24 Description: Advantech PCI-1723
25 Author: yonggang <rsmgnu@gmail.com>, Ian Abbott <abbotti@mev.co.uk>
26 Devices: [Advantech] PCI-1723 (adv_pci1723)
27 Updated: Mon, 14 Apr 2008 15:12:56 +0100
28 Status: works
29
30 Configuration Options:
31 [0] - PCI bus of device (optional)
32 [1] - PCI slot of device (optional)
33
34 If bus/slot is not specified, the first supported
35 PCI device found will be used.
36
37 Subdevice 0 is 8-channel AO, 16-bit, range +/- 10 V.
38
39 Subdevice 1 is 16-channel DIO. The channels are configurable as input or
40 output in 2 groups (0 to 7, 8 to 15). Configuring any channel implicitly
41 configures all channels in the same group.
42
43 TODO:
44
45 1. Add the two milliamp ranges to the AO subdevice (0 to 20 mA, 4 to 20 mA).
46 2. Read the initial ranges and values of the AO subdevice at start-up instead
47 of reinitializing them.
48 3. Implement calibration.
49 */
